Values and calculations
All radii, once calculated, are divided by Template:Val to convert from m to Template:Solar radius.
- AD
- radius determined from angular diameter and distance
- D is multiplied by Template:Val to convert from kpc to m
- L/Teff
- radius calculated from bolometric luminosity and effective temperature per the Stefan–Boltzmann law
- If is provided, is used
- L is multiplied by Template:Val to convert from solar luminosity to watts
